Research Overview
Key Research Interests:
- Conservation of aquatic systems
- Drivers influencing biological community structure and biodiversity patterns
- Bioacoustic monitoring in aquatic systems
- Animal behaviour
- Global change and aquatic systems

Teaching Responsibilities
Programme coordination:
SBS Postgraduate Teaching coordinator
Co-coordinator of the MSc programme in Environmental Management
Course coordination and teaching:
Level 2 Ecology: lectures on population growth
Level 2 Conservation Biology: Lectures on PVA analysis, biodiversity, reintroductions and MPAs
Level 2 Freshwater and Terrestrial Ecology field course
Level 3 Behavioural Biology: lectures on parasites, predators, foraging theory and reproduction
Level 3 Animals in captivity: lectures on the ethics of keeping fish in captivity
Level 5 Environmental pollution: lectures on freshwater pollution
Level 5 Catchment management: lectures and coordination
Level 5 Core Skills in Environmental Sciences: coordination and lectures on statistical analyses and sampling designs
